Bullets fly at multiple Akron homes, woman shot while driving around illegally parked vehicle

Police said an innocent woman was shot inside her car and several Akron homes were struck by stray bullets around 7:30 p.m. Wednesday.

Multiple shots were fired at a 48-year-old mother as she attempted to drive around a car traveling on the wrong side of  Frederick Boulevard near Slosson Street.

The woman, who asked not to be identified, said she suffered gunshot wounds to her arm, clavicle and her side.

"It's a senseless crime. It was wrong. They don't know me. It was for no reason."

Police believe the shots were fired from at least two guns-- an assault rifle and a pistol.

Two to four suspects got away in red, Dodge Charger, according to Lt. Rick Edwards.

The woman was treated at Akron General Medical Center with non-life-threatening injuries and released. On Thursday, she told newsnet5.com that she was returning to a hospital because her arm was bleeding again.

The shooters remain at large. Akron police ask that anyone with information on this shooting call the police department at (330) 375-2181.
